Standing water in your living room can be a nightmare. Not only does it damage walls, floors, and furniture, but it also poses serious health risks. Mold and mildew can start growing within 24 to 48 hours, contaminating the air you breathe. That’s why it’s crucial to call a professional as soon as you spot water damage. Warning Signs You Need Living Room Water Removal

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Musty smells can be a sign of mold and mildew growth. If you notice a strong, unpleasant odor in your living room, it’s essential to call a professional to inspect and remediate the area.

Water Stains on Walls and Ceilings

Water stains can be a sign of water damage or leaks. If you notice water spots or discoloration on your walls or ceiling, it’s crucial to investigate the source and address the issue quickly.

Warped or Buckled Flooring

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of water damage or excessive moisture. If you notice your flooring is uneven or damaged, it’s essential to call a professional to inspect and repair the area.

Peeling Paint or Wallpaper

Peeling paint or wallpaper can be a sign of water damage or excessive moisture. If you notice your paint or wallpaper is peeling, it’s crucial to investigate the source and address the issue quickly.

Living Room Water Removal vs. DIY: When to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Large-scale water damage (e.g., floodwater) No Yes DIY methods can’t handle large quantities of water, and delays can lead to mold and mildew growth.
Water damage with structural elements (e.g., walls, ceilings) No Yes Structural elements need specialized expertise and equipment to repair, and DIY methods can lead to further damage and safety risks.
Hidden water damage (e.g., behind walls or under flooring) No Yes Hidden water damage needs specialized equipment and expertise to detect and repair, and DIY methods can lead to further damage and safety risks.
Water damage with sensitive equipment or electronics No Yes Water damage to sensitive equipment or electronics needs specialized care and expertise to prevent further damage and data loss.
Water damage with insurance claims No Yes Insurance companies need professional documentation and verification of water damage, and DIY methods can lead to disputes and delays.
Water damage with hidden health risks (e.g., mold, mildew) No Yes Hidden health risks need specialized expertise and equipment to detect and remediate, and DIY methods can lead to further health risks and safety concerns.

With living room water removal, it’s crucial to call a professional if you’re unsure about the extent of the damage or the best course of action. DIY methods can lead to further damage, safety risks, and health concerns, and may void your insurance claims.

Living Room Water Removal Cost in Saugus, MA

The cost of living room water remov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Saugus, MA. These estimates are based on industry standards and may not reflect your actual costs. Prices start at $500 and can range up to $2,500 or more depending on the extent of the damage and the services required.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water extraction and removal $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local labor costs
Drying and dehumidification $1,000 – $3,000 Equipment rental costs, labor costs, and duration of the process
Sanitizing and deodorizing $500 – $2,000 Equipment rental costs, labor costs, and duration of the process
Final inspection and certification $200 – $500 Duration of the process and labor costs
Emergency response and mobilization $500 – $1,500 Location, labor costs, and equipment rental costs
Insurance claims and documentation $500 – $1,500 Duration of the process, labor costs, and insurance company requirements
